#6b473f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6b473f is composed of 42% red, 27.8%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.6% magenta, 41.1%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 10.9 degrees, a saturation of 25.9% and a lightness of 33.3%. #6b473f color hex could be obtained by blending #d68e7e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#6b473f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080505 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b473f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575353 is the less saturated color, while #a62204 is the most saturated one.
